ORDINANCE AMENDMENT

Acct. No. 315052 -3 Permit No. 1111013

 

 

 

 

BE IT ORDAINED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F CHICAGO:

 

 

Section 1:

 

 

The ordinance passed by the City Council of the City of Chicago for FINAL KUTZ BARBERSHOP on 04/02/2014, and printed upon page 77817 of the Journal of Proceedings of the City of Chicago is here by Amended by deleting the words "1372 W. 79th St" and inserting in their place the words "1374 W. 79th St"

 

 

Section 2:

 

This ordinance Amendment shall be in effect upon its passage.
